Roselise
Pronunciation: ROH-zə-leez
Meaning
Rose and lily
Origin
Latin, Germanic
About Roselise
Roselise offers a distinctly elegant and soft choice, blending the timeless appeal of two beloved floral names: the classic rose and the pure lily. This unique combination, rooted in both Latin and Hebrew traditions, evokes a sense of gentle sophistication that feels both familiar and refreshingly uncommon. Parents drawn to names with a vintage charm, perhaps from the early to mid-20th century, will appreciate Roselise's classic yet understated beauty. It’s a name that whispers rather than shouts, perfect for a family seeking something graceful and established, but with a unique, lyrical lilt that sets it apart from more common floral choices.
